  • FL and The DPI Group) has a current opening for a Security Manager in our Tallahassee, Florida office to service the Northern Florida Region.
This role oversees the staffing, scheduling, and on-site training for security guards and ensures exceptional quality is provided to our customers. This position will require travel between our customer sites along the northern region of Florida utilizing a company-provided vehicle, as well as working in office at least two days per week. Duties/Responsibilities:
Manage the overall performance of the location to achieve revenue, margin and profitability targets. Oversee day-to-day security operations across all assigned sites, ensuring every post is covered, compliant, and performing to standard. Identify, pursue and close new security contracts across the territory.
Prospect actively:
build a pipeline, network locally, and generate leads alongside any company-provided opportunities. Conduct site assessments and prepare proposals, pricing, and presentations for prospective clients. Partner with leadership on bids, RFPs, and pricing strategy; represent DPI Security at local industry and community events. Cultivate and maintain strong client relationships and ensure contracted service exceeds expectations. Recruit, lead, coach, and develop site supervisors and security officers; set clear expectations and hold the team accountable for professionalism and results Prepare schedules; ensure accurate and timely completion of all timesheets, data entry, and documentation. Travel within the local area to coordinate new Security Guard starts, check-in with customers, address Security Guard performance concerns, develop/nurture community partnerships. Order equipment as needed. Conduct personnel investigations and prepare coaching forms when needed.
Other Requirements:
Ten (10) or more years of security experience, Law Enforcement, or Military One (1) or more years of security management experience Exceptional interpersonal and customer service skills within a diverse environment Computer literate, experienced in the use of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ook Demonstrated dependability and accountability Ability to collaboratively work in a client-focused role within a fast-paced environment. Ability to handle competing priorities and meet deadlines while maintaining high level of accuracy Must have and maintain a current state security certification and driver's license The position offers a competitive salary and full benefits packet within a collaborative team environment.
